[arch-commits] Commit in cx_freeze/trunk (PKGBUILD)

Ray Rashif schiv at archlinux.org
Wed Dec 15 19:41:03 UTC 2010


    Date: Wednesday, December 15, 2010 @ 14:41:02
  Author: schiv
Revision: 103138

upgpkg: cx_freeze 4.2.1-1
upstream release

Modified:
  cx_freeze/trunk/PKGBUILD

----------+
 PKGBUILD |   29 ++++++++++++++++-------------
 1 file changed, 16 insertions(+), 13 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2010-12-15 19:36:53 UTC (rev 103137)
+++ PKGBUILD	2010-12-15 19:41:02 UTC (rev 103138)
@@ -1,27 +1,30 @@
 # $Id$
-# Maintainer: Douglas Soares de Andrade <douglas at archlinux.org>
+# Maintainer: Ray Rashif <schiv at archlinux.org
+# Contributor: Douglas Soares de Andrade <douglas at archlinux.org>
 # Contributor: Eric Belanger <eric at archlinux.org>
 # Contributor: Roberto Alsina <ralsina at kde.org>
 
 pkgname=cx_freeze
-pkgver=4.1
-pkgrel=2
+_tarname=cx_Freeze
+pkgver=4.2.1
+pkgrel=1
 pkgdesc="A set of utilities for freezing Python scripts into executables"
 arch=('i686' 'x86_64')
 url="http://www.python.net/crew/atuining/cx_Freeze/"
 license=('custom')
 depends=('python2')
-source=(http://downloads.sourceforge.net/sourceforge/cx-freeze/cx_Freeze-$pkgver.tar.gz FreezePython.sh)
+source=("http://downloads.sourceforge.net/cx-freeze/$_tarname-$pkgver.tar.gz"
+        'FreezePython.sh')
+md5sums=('aa4dd1486a5290fbac797c1aa4cc52a7'
+         '5cc60d1644eba12a57c22cc1348a4afd')
 
-build() {
-  cd $srcdir/cx_Freeze-$pkgver
+package() {
+  cd "$srcdir/$_tarname-$pkgver"
 
-  python2 setup.py install --root $pkgdir
+  python2 setup.py install --root "$pkgdir/" --optimize 1
 
-  install -d $pkgdir/usr/share/cx-freeze/{bases,initscripts}
-  install -m755 source/bases/* $pkgdir/usr/share/cx-freeze/bases
-  install -m644 initscripts/* $pkgdir/usr/share/cx-freeze/initscripts
-  install -D -m644 LICENSE.txt $pkgdir/usr/share/licenses/cx_freeze/COPYING
+  install -d "$pkgdir"/usr/share/cx-freeze/{bases,initscripts}
+  install -m755 source/bases/* "$pkgdir/usr/share/cx-freeze/bases"
+  install -m644 initscripts/* "$pkgdir/usr/share/cx-freeze/initscripts"
+  install -D -m644 LICENSE.txt "$pkgdir/usr/share/licenses/cx_freeze/COPYING"
 }
-md5sums=('a096ea2b7d04edfe95c16307ba86d637'
-         '5cc60d1644eba12a57c22cc1348a4afd')




More information about the arch-commits mailing list